Q: Is 30,211,252 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 30,211,252 is not a prime number.

Why is 30,211,252 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 30211252 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 881 1,762 3,524 8,573 17,146 34,292 7,552,813 15,105,626 and 30,211,252, with no remainder.

Since 30,211,252 cannot be divided by just 1 and 30,211,252, it is not a prime number.
